For student Rachel Foley ’19, she wasn’t going to wait until her junior or senior year to secure an internship in the accounting sector. At the end of her first year at Adelphi University’s Robert B. Willumstad School of Business, Foley was able to join Nassau County’s Department of Human Services as an auditing intern where she worked alongside the fiscal director to analyze and confirm audit claims.

“The most exciting and advantageous part of this internship was the experience I gained outside of the office while auditing individual agencies. After learning how to audit an agency, I was trusted to perform 13 other audits on my own,” explained Foley about her first internship experience. “Because of this experience, I was able to develop as a professional in ways that I never expected. Fortunately, I had the opportunity to learn how to work within a team, how to work in an office setting, and how to conduct myself in a professional manner in all sorts of situations.”

Thanks to her experiences at the Department of Human Services, she was able to secure an internship at Merrill Lynch, where she experienced a different culture and sector of the business world. At Merrill Lynch, Foley was able to work with many teams within the company including the Office Management Team, the Financial Advisors and the Operations Team on various projects.

“One of the most noticeable differences between the two companies was the size, however I was able to quickly adjust,” noted Foley. “Looking back on it, I am glad that these internships were very different from each other because if they weren’t, I would have learned the same things twice. Instead, I was able to double my knowledge base and apply what I learned from both internships to projects that I’m currently working on.”

With both internships completed, Foley is grateful for Adelphi resources that provided her with the opportunities to further her career in an accounting firm upon graduation.

“Without the help from Adelphi, and the resources it has provided me with, I wouldn’t have had the opportunity to intern with the Department of Human Services or Merrill Lynch,” said Foley. “Professor Passarella and The Center for Career and professional development have helped me create and revise countless resumes and cover letters to ensure I am sending a perfect representation of myself to each and every company.”

Foley also offered some words of advice for other Adelphi students seeking out an internship:

“The best advice that I could give to anyone searching for an internship is to be persistent throughout the whole process. Rather than going on one interview and waiting four to six weeks to hear back from that company, use that time to do research and go on other interviews. Your chances of acquiring an internship are much higher in that case, and you might be lucky enough to have a few offers when those four to six weeks elapse,” Foley advised. “Searching for an internship is a job itself, and to be successful you really have to put a lot of hard work and dedication into it.”
